Things to Consider before Buying a Rustic Hot Tub In Connecticut

The popularity of rustic décor has shifted the way we view home improvement and enhancements. The charm of reclaimed wood and cool natural stone adds a modern flair to the home without compromising warmth.

Over the past few years, wooden hot tubs have reemerged as a cost-effective sustainable option for backyard soaking that adds that rustic feel to the outdoor space. Before taking the plunge, here are a few things to consider when buying a wooden hot tub.

  • Size and Location - The size of the tub depends on one's preference, of course. Smaller tubs are more intimate and easier to place than larger ones. Choose a location with a firm foundation, as a fully-filled tub will be heavy. Remember to consider the view and any privacy needs when picking the location.
  • Wood Type -  Wood options include Spruce, Oak Larch and Red Cedar, each with advantages regarding durability, color and lifespan.
  • Heating System - The heating stove can be exterior, interior, or intergrated. Interior stoves take space within the tub while exterior or integrated heaters are placed outside. An interior stove needs more protection and maintenance, but tends to be the least expensive.
  • Maintenance - Unlike its in-ground counterparts, wooden hot tubs require careful maintenance. The wood needs proper care, and the stove and water area should be covered and insulated when not in use.

Wooden hot tubs have made a comeback as more and more homeowners search for design elements that add a classic look to their homes. Combining modern efficiency and rustic desgin, choosing the right tub will bring enjoyment to your outdoor space.
